BSP Leader Mayawati demands CBI probe in Armstrong’s murder case

Bahujan Samaj Party chief Mayawati, who paid her last respect to Tamil Nadu BSP Chief K Armstrong, demanded a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) probe into the cold-blooded murder of the party’s Tamil Nadu chief.

Meanwhile, the Tamil Nadu police suspect the alleged involvement of the associates of a slain gangster, who has been identified as Arcot Suresh. The BSP Chief also claimed that those arrested by the police are actually not the real culprits and that the killers are still absconding from the police. “The way he was killed, shows there is nothing called law and order in Tamil Nadu. Those who have killed him, the real culprits have not been nabbed,” Mayawati claimed.

The BSP Chief also threatened the state government that her party would soon launch a protest if the police fail to arrest the real culprits behind the murder.
“Our party has taken this incident very seriously and we will not sit quietly. Our state unit will not sit quiet and will exert pressure on the state government to refer this case to the CBI… I will pray to god to give his family and supporters strength to bear the loss… To ensure action against the accused, the party cadre should come forward but at the same time, stay within the limits of law and show that the weaker section does not take the law into their hands,” she added.
